Understanding Direct Thermal Labels and How They Work



Direct thermal labels are widely used where efficient and economical labelling is required. Unlike traditional printing methods, a direct thermal printer applies heat to produce print on specially coated material, removing the need for ink, toner, or ribbons.



This simple process makes them ideal for temporary, high-output tasks such as shipping, logistics, retail, and healthcare. The efficient operation needs little upkeep, which is beneficial in fast-paced operations.



Why Businesses Choose a Direct Thermal Label Printer



A direct thermal label printer removes the need for consumables, helping to reduce ongoing costs. For businesses handling frequent shipments or stock movement, this can lead to cost efficiency over time.



The process is fast and easy. With reduced mechanical complexity and no ribbon changes, interruptions are reduced. These labels are ideal for short-term use, such as e-commerce shipping labels, where readability is required throughout the delivery process.

Choosing the Right Direct Thermal Label Rolls



Selecting appropriate direct thermal label rolls is essential for consistent results. Key considerations include:



  • Dimensions to match printer compatibility

  • Adhesion level, such as permanent or removable

  • Operating conditions, including heat, light, or moisture

  • Print quality requirements, especially for machine readability



A well-matched label roll can minimise issues and support reliable output.

Direct Thermal Labels Properties and Maintenance



Direct thermal labels are best suited for short-term use and operate without consumables. By contrast, thermal transfer labels are longer lasting and suited to extended use.



To maintain performance, it is recommended to:



  • Clean the printhead regularly

  • Use high-quality labels

  • Store rolls correctly



Regular care helps prolong printer life and ensure consistent output.
